Development Engineer for Hydraulic Systems in Mobile Machinery | Entwicklungsingenieur (m/w/d) Hydraulische Systeme für mobile Arbeitsmaschinen
NeXaT GmbH
Job Summary
This role offers a unique opportunity to contribute to the next generation of agricultural machinery by designing and optimizing hydraulic systems. The successful candidate will be responsible for developing hydraulic plans, considering dynamic properties, and managing requirements for machine functions. Day-to-day tasks include testing subsystems on test benches and directly on machines, conducting field validations, and collaborating closely with design and software development teams to implement new machine ideas. This position is ideal for someone passionate about hydraulics, eager to innovate, and looking to make a significant impact in a pioneering field, working on globally unique projects with a high degree of creative freedom and opportunities for professional growth.
Required Skills
Education
Completed technical vocational training or a degree in Mechanical Engineering, Mechatronics, or a related field
Experience
- Professional experience in the design, installation, commissioning, and troubleshooting of hydraulic systems
- Ideally, experience in mobile hydraulics, open circuit, and LS-systems
- Professional experience focusing on open circuit systems, switching and proportional valve technology, and LS-systems
